I am a PhD candidate at Delft Institute of Applied Mathematics (DIAM) in the group of Applied Probability under the supervision of Richard C. Kraaij.
My PhD project spans both Probability and Analysis of PDE: my research is indeed mainly concerned with the study of Hamilton -Jacobi equations and the use of them in the theory of Large deviations for Markov processes.
